Saucy and sweet, this bowl is the perfect pick me up!
Ingredients
1 package Pit Boss Pulled ‘Pork’ BBQ
1/4 cup extra BBQ sauce
2 tbsp pineapple juice
juice from 1 lime
3/4 cups fresh pineapple chunks
1-2 jalapeños, chopped and seeded
2 tbsp fresh cilantro, chopped
kosher salt and pepper
2 cups cooked quinoa or rice
1/2 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
1/4 cup fresh basil, and or cilantro leaves, roughly chopped
1 1/2 cups shredded romaine lettuce
1 avocado, sliced
The How-To
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il in a large heavy-bottomed pot over medium-high heat. When the oil shimmers, add the Pit Boss and season with salt and pepper. Sear Pit Boss about 3-4 minutes.
Reduce the heat to low and add 1/4 cup BBQ sauce, pineapple juice, juice of 1 lime, 1/4 cup pineapple chunks, and half the jalapeño. Cover and simmer on low for 10 minutes. If the sauce gets too thick, add water to thin it out.
After 10 minutes, stir in the cilantro and extra BBQ sauce, if desired.
Meanwhile, make the salsa. In a bowl toss together the remaining 1/2 cup of pineapple chunks, remaining jalapeño, tomatoes, basil and/or cilantro, lime juice, and a pinch of salt.
Divide the quinoa among bowls and top with the lettuce, pineapple salsa, the Pineapple Pit Boss, and avocado. Drizzle with the remaining BBQ sauce left in the bowl.
